Laura Mae Anderson was born in 1901 in Lake City, Clare, Michigan, USA, the child of John Emmet Frank Anderson And Sarah Ann Jennie Emeott. In 1910, Laura Mae Anderson resided in Saginaw, Saginaw, Michigan, USA. In 1920, Laura Mae Anderson resided in Saginaw, Saginaw, Michigan, USA. Laura Mae Anderson married Rudolph Christian Zauel, and had children including Elaine Zauel, Lorraine Zauel, Mary Jane Zauel, Roland Arthur Zauel, Rudy J Zauel Jr. Laura Mae Anderson passed away in 1973 in Saginaw, Saginaw, Michigan, USA.
